The series is about a woman named Cat who hunts vampires. In this world, vampires are a bit different from in other books. And Cat realizes that there's a lot more she needs to know before she can really start making a dent in the vampire population. She is also a half vampire herself.
A lot of people enjoy the series, a lot of people the series because of Bones. He's the male vampire character in the book and he is mighty sexy!
